Handing off the Quillbus compaction work before I rotate to the Ferntide team. The compactor now runs per-partition instead of globally, which fixed the stalls we saw during peak replay. Watch the tombstone retention logic in compactor/sweep.go — it's correct but subtle, and Marit's review comments there are worth reading first. Dead-letter segments are still compacted on the old schedule; that's intentional. The staging broker is already running with the new settings, reproduced below.

settings of fafog-haduf:
ZORIX_PIN=4648
ZORIX_METRICS_HOST=metrics.zorix.paliqsys.corp
ZORIX_LOG_LEVEL=info
ZORIX_TENANT=druix

Handover for tonight, Prisha — spare hardware for the Oakfen rollout is now in storage room G4, not the old cage. Replacement switches are on the left shelving, laptops in the locked tote. Log anything you take on the sheet taped inside the door. G4's keypad was rekeyed this afternoon, so use the code below.

staff pass of kawip-hawef = bdg-QLP-2

Vendor note for support: the Pairwell matching service is hosted by Orbane Cloud, and the intermittent GC pauses customers report (30–90 second match delays, usually mid-afternoon) are a known issue on their JVM tier. Orbane has committed to a heap-tuning fix next quarter. In the meantime, do not restart the service; pauses self-resolve. Log affected match IDs in the shared tracker. For pause events exceeding five minutes, notify Orbane's support queue directly.

alerts address for yajof-kahog: eliax@qirvanlabs.corp